OVERVIEW
The TD4 dies el fuel s ys t em i ncorporat es a l ow and hi gh-pres sure (HP) ci rcuit t o provide the engine wit h s uffi cient fuel forall operat ing condi ti ons . The l ow-pres s ure (LP) sys tem compri ses :
Molded pl as t ic s addle-t ype fuel t ankFuel deli very module (wi th integral i n-t ank pump)Fuel l evel s ens orsFuel s upply and return li nesFuel fil ter as sembl y.
• NOTE: Fuel i s drawn from t he fuel t ank by the engine mount ed li ft pump. The i n-t ank pump does not deli ver fuel t o t heengi ne, and onl y delivers fuel through the 2 jet pumps t o maint ain fuel in t he fuel deli very pot.
The HP s ys tem features a Bos ch Generati on 3 common rail inject ion s ys tem.For addit ional informat ion, refer t o: Fuel Chargi ng and Cont rol s (303-04B Fuel Charging and Cont rols - TD4 2.2L Di esel ,Des cript ion and Operat ion).
FUEL TANK CONSTRUCTION
Page 1582 of 3229

The fuel t ank has a useable capaci ty of 68.0 li ters (18.0 US gal lons) and i s des igned wit h a run dry s trat egy t o prevent ai rentering t he HP fuel s ys tem. The t ank is formed from a 6-layer lami nat ed blow-molded pl as t ic t o provi de high mechani cals trengt h and complet e emis s ions i ntegri ty. The t ank is a sealed uni t wit h i nt ernal acces s being via the fuel del iverymodule apert ure locat ed on t he Right -Hand (RH) s ide of t he tank.
The fuel t ank is l ocat ed cent rall y below the rear s eat posi ti on and is formed to s traddl e the drives haft and exhaus ts ys t em.
A mount ing cradl e and 6 bolt s s ecure t he fuel tank t o t he vehi cle. W hen t he cradle is at tached to the chass i s, t he t ank isposi ti vel y s ecured via foam pads t hat bear agai nst t he underfl oor. The cradle is manufact ured from st eel and incorporateslarge diamet er s t eel t ubing t o prot ect t he fuel t ank leading edge from underbody damage. The cradle al so provides thelocati on for t he parking brake cable bracket s .
A s addle s haped heat s hiel d is at t ached t o t he cradle t o prot ect the fuel t ank from exhaust s ys tem temperature.

Internal Mounting Bracket
The int ernal mount ing bracket i s molded i nto t he t ank cas ing and provi des the locat ion for the breather val ve, andcros sover tube as s embly.

The fuel deli very module i s located in t he RH s i de of the t ank, and i s s ecured to the bot tom of the t ank wit h a weldedbayonet-t ype lock ri ng. The t op flange of the fuel del ivery module ass embly provides t he int ernal and ext ernal interface fort he tank elect rical and fuel connecti ons . The flange is formed wit h a 6-pin ext ernal el ect ri cal connector t hat is connect ed tot he 2 MAPPS fuel l evel s ens ors , and t he in-tank pump.
